
Trick for students to still watch BBC iPlayer or live TV without a TV licence
New rules came into effect today that mean you need a TV licence to watch BBC iPlayer, even if you’re only watching catch-up. Until now, you only needed a licence for watching live broadcasts – though you can continue to watch other catch-up services without one.
